Top Tips for Choosing the Perfect Dog Toy
Choosing the right toy for your furry friend can be a challenge. But don't worry! Here are some tricks to help you find the ideal match. First, consider your dog's scale and power. A small toy might be simple to destroy for a large breed, while a giant chew toy could be too much for a pup. Next, determine what your dog enjoys doing. Do they love to run balls? Or are they more of a cuddle? You can also look for toys that stimulate their minds, like puzzle toys or treat-dispensing options.
- Always supervise your dog when they're playing with toys.
- Regularly examine toys for damage and swap them if needed.
- Keep in mind that every dog is different, so what works for one pup might not work for another. It might take a little testing to find the perfect fit!

Decoding Canine Cues: Understanding Your Dog's Fun Preference
Every dog has a unique personality, and that extends to their play style. Some pups are calm, preferring leisurely games of fetch or gentle tug-of-war. Others are energetic, always ready for a high-speed chase or an intense round of hide-and-seek. Learning your dog's preferences can deepen your bond and make playtime even more enjoyable for both of you.
- Watch your dog's body language during play. Do they wag their tail with a soft rhythm, or are they prancing around?
- Reflect on the types of toys your dog favors . Do they prefer durable toys? Balls? Puzzle toys?
- Experiment different play activities to see what your dog responds to.
By paying attention to these cues, you can understand the secrets to your dog's playful personality and create a rewarding playtime experience for both of you.
